Output 831724dab4c667408b12c4e3c5d925b44fb150f53a9616af6d13aa609e47dc8b:4

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 d3daa9457f9bfff17786730a8ea8fedf4d7626f6
address
bc1q60d2j3tln0llzauxwv9ga287maxhvfhkphx09y
transaction
831724dab4c667408b12c4e3c5d925b44fb150f53a9616af6d13aa609e47dc8b
spent
true